NEW CITY – A Congers woman was arrested Monday for the hit-and-run death of Manuel Aguaiza of New City on December 19, 2017.
Following a lengthy criminal investigation, Clarkstown Police detectives arrested Jodi Sarf, 48, who surrendered to police with her attorney. She was charged with leaving the scene of an accident with injury resulting in death as a felony. Sarf was arraigned and released on her own recognizance.
At about 10:30 p.m. on December 19, Aguaiza, 40, was crossing Route 304
at Third Street in New City when he was struck by an SUV. He was transported
to Nyack Hospital where he later died.
